Late last year Mozilla announced that it'd be moving its Firefox browser to a native Android user interface , instead of using XUL, and it's been pushing nightly builds since November . Today, those builds have reached beta status and are available directly from Google Play. You'll get the same excellent Firefox browsing experience you've come to know and love, only with an even better UI, faster load times and better performance.

Samsung has been rather forthcoming when it comes to telling folks what devices will be updated to Android 4.0 Ice Cream Sandwich . The list of eligible devices has been updated a couple times now but one carrier; namely, T-Mobile has remained missing off that list until recently. The newly updated list now features in total, four T-Mobile devices: Samsung Galaxy S II (SGH-t989) Samsung Galaxy S Blaze 4G (SGH-t769) Samsung Galaxy Tab 7.0 Plus (SGH-t869) Samsung Galaxy Tab 10.1 (SGH-t859) Not surprisingly, they don't differ all that much from the various other carriers out there but it is nice to see T-Mobile added and that leaves us with the impression Samsung and T-Mobile have at least a general idea of when things will get rolling out to the masses
